Fisherwick Tournament Report

Fisherwick Chess Club ran a go-as-you-please tournament throughout the winter months.

Competitors had to play at least 10 games to be eligible for a prize, with the prizes going to those with the best percentage scores. The time limit was each player having 1 hour 15 minutes for all moves. The tournament was a very closely fought affair. Gareth Annesley was leading gouing into the final night, when he was beaten by Desmond Moreland. Nicholas Pilkiewixz, last year's champion, beat Jim McLean to win the tournament. Meanwhile Robin Triggs beat Paul McLoughlin to wrest the runner-up spot from Ian Davis. The latter had to be content with a grading Prize but the luckless Annesley ended out of the prize list altogether. Also a bit unlucky was Desmond Moreland, who only played 9 games. He wanted to play 2 games in the final night to give himself a chance of a prize, but there simply wasn't enough time.

Winner           Nicholas Pilkiewicz  R.V.H. Played 16 Won 8 Lost 3 Drew 5 65.6%
Runner-up        Robin Triggs         Q.U.B. Played 10 Won 6 Lost 3 Drew 1 65.0%
Grading Prize A  Ian Davis                   Played 17 Won 8 Lost 3 Drew 6 64.7%
Grading Prize B  Damien Lavery        R.V.H. Played 12 Won 5 Lost 6 Drew 1 45.8%

Other leading scores
Gareth Annesley R.V.H. 63.3% Ian Woodfield Fisherwick 62.5% Tom Alcorn Fisherwick 61.5% Desmond Moreland Randalstown 61.1% Jim McLean Fisherwick 59.3%
